the difference between the squares of two numbers is 32. twice the square of the first number increased by the square of the second number is 76. find the numbers.​

Answer:

The numbers are 6 and 2

6 squared = 36

2 squared = 4

So 36-4 = 32

And 36 x 2 = 72 + 4 = 76
